Mr. Clyde Dee York age 77 of Hicks Gap Rd.
Blairsville formerly of Pavo, GA. passed away on Friday July 9,2010 in
the Union County Nursing Home following an extended illness. Mr. York
was born on July 3,1933 in Senica, SC., the son of the late Arvil York
and the late Bertie Mae Graham York. He was a veteran of the US Army. He
was a loving father, brother and grandfather. Mr. York was a member of
the Nazarene Church in Moultrie, GA. Patricia West Dent Krick, age 73,
passed peacefully to her Lord and Savior at Emory University Hospital on
July 11, 2010, after a brief illness. She was the loving wife of Charles
S. Krick III of Blairsville, Georgia. She was preceded in death by her
husband of 40 years, William Henry Dent, and by a son, Michael Kenyon
Dent. Mrs. Krick was born March 21, 1937, in Sandersville, Georgia. Her parents were the late Jesse Kenyon West and the late Ella Bennett West. She graduated from Morgan County High School and was Valedictorian of the Class of 1955. She attended Young Harris College with the Class of 1957 and went on to graduate with Honors earning a BBA in accounting from Georgia College in Milledgeville. As a young wife and mother in Fort Valley, Georgia, she was an active member of Fort Valley Presbyterian Church. She was a gifted pianist and served as the Director and accompanist of The Children’s Choir. She was a member of Women of the Church, a Vacation Bible School teacher, and faithfully played the piano for Sunday and special services. She was a devoted mother and very supportive as a volunteer in her children’s activities including Cub Scouts, Little League, and recreational sports. She was an excellent cook and enjoyed entertaining in her home and hosting Bridge Club and family friends. As the children reached school age, she was employed by Woolfolk Chemical Company in the accounting department, and in later years went on to serve as Chief Financial Officer of W Supply Company in Macon and was the owner of The Flower Basket florist in Warner Robins, Georgia. She was a faithful alumna of Young Harris College and served as the longtime class coordinator for the Class of 1957. With retirement and a move to Blairsville in the mountains of North Georgia, she remained a devoted grandmother as well as a member of the Friends of the Library Board and the Misty Mountain Quilters Guild where she served as treasurer for both organizations. Mrs. Krick was an active member of the Kiwanis Club of Blairsville where she served on the Board of Directors and was a dedicated and faithful volunteer for Meals On Wheels and numerous community groups. She attended Hayesville Presbyterian Church where again she shared her God-given talents in the music department. In addition to her husband, Mrs. Krick is survived by her sons, Dr. Jeffrey J. | Mr. Steven Howard Cox
age 64 of Bowers Circle Blairsville passed away on Monday July 12, 2010
in the Union General Hospital following an extended illness. Mr. Cox was
born on Sept.7,1945 in New Port News, VA., the son of Willie Mae Moore
Cox and the late Charlie Hampton Cox. Steve was a 1965 graduate of
Greene Central High School in Snow Hill, NC. He was a veteran of the US
Air Force and had retired from Delta Airlines in 1997 with over twenty
seven years of service. Steve and his wife, Delga sang gospel music all
over the tri state area. He loved people and will be missed by his many
friends. Mr. Cox was a member of Saints Delight Baptist Church.
